當一個組件需要獲取多個狀態時候,將這些狀態都聲明為計算屬性會有些重復和冗余。為了解決這個問題,我們可以使用 mapState 輔助函數幫助我們生成計算屬性。 mapState 函數返回的是一個對象。我們如何將它與局部計算屬性混合使用呢?通常,我們需要使用一個工具函數將多個對象 ...
當一個組件需要獲取多個狀態時候,將這些狀態都聲明為計算屬性會有些重復和冗余。為了解決這個問題,我們可以使用 mapState 輔助函數幫助我們生成計算屬性。 mapState 函數返回的是一個對象。我們如何將它與局部計算屬性混合使用呢?通常,我們需要使用一個工具函數將多個對象 ...
vuex:同一狀態(全局狀態)管理,簡單的理解,在SPA單頁面組件的開發中,在state中定義了一個數據之后,你可以在所在項目中的任何一個組件里進行獲取、修改,並且你的修改可以同步全局。 1,安裝 npm i vuex --save 2,在src文件目錄下新建store>index.js ...
VueX的基本使用 1、什么是VueX Vuex 是一個專為 Vue.js 應用程序開發的狀態管理模式。它采用集中式存儲管理應用的所有組件的狀態,並以相應的規則保證狀態以一種可預測的方式發生變化。 以上是官方文檔的介紹,我淺顯的理解VueX就是用於存儲一些全局配置,可以在不同的組件中使用 ...
vue概念:vuex 是 Vue 配套的 公共數據管理工具,它可以把一些共享的數據,保存到 vuex 中,方便 整個程序中的任何組件直接獲取或修改我們的公共數據; 配置vuex的步驟: 1、運行cnpm i vuex -S 2、導包 3、將vuex注冊到vue中 ...
1. methods: mapActions('user', { login (dispatch) { dispatch('loginA ...
使用vuex,首先得了解它是用來干什么的?===>實現數據共享的。 第一步:在項目中引入vuex ①在項目目錄下,使用npm引入vuex:npm install vuex --save ②在項目的src中創建一個以store命名的文件夾,在store下創建一個以index.js命名 ...
1、安裝vuex依賴包 2、導入vuex包 3、創建 store 對象 4、將 store 對象掛載到 vue 實例中 Vuex 是一個專為 Vue.js 應用程序開發的狀態管理模式。它采用集中式存儲管理應用的所有組件的狀態,並以相應 ...